Solution Overview

Problem

The distribution of newspapers and other perishable publications remains largely manual and labor-intensive, leading to inefficiencies in allocation and tracking, resulting in lost revenue and wasted stock due to inaccurate demand analysis and monitoring.

Innovation Solution

A system utilizing portable handheld devices for delivery personnel to collect and manage delivery route information, aggregate data for business reports, and communicate with a database for improved tracking and billing, eliminating the need for paper records and enhancing the accuracy of deliveries and returns.

Data Source

PatentUS7627535B2Method and apparatus for supporting delivery, sale and billing of perishable and time-sensitive goods such as newspapers, periodicals and direct marketing and promotional materials
Publication Date: 2009.12.01 CENT SVILUPPO MATERIALI SPA

AI summary

Tracking, controlling, optimizing, and managing delivery of newspapers, periodicals and promotional materials to retail outlets is performed using a web server, a database server, and handheld computers. Newspapers or periodicals may be delivered based at least in part on the information displayed on the hand held devices, which are also used to collect information during said delivery. The collected information is communicated to the database for billing, reporting and analysis Intelligent advanced shuffle handling and tracking is provided.
